SMOKY SALSA

Salsa is one of the sauces typical to Mexican cuisine used as a dip. Salsa is mainly a tomato based dip, and includes ingredients such as onion, peppers, lime juice and salt. There are many variations of salsa. But this homemade salsa is much better than any store bought or even of any restaurant. Salsa varies in flavor from mild to extra spicy. I am using Chipotle pepper in adobe sauce which gives this salsa a very distinctive smoky flavor and habanero pepper for an extra spiciness. The best part of this homemade salsa is that it can be customized to your taste.

Ingredients:
1 can, 14.5 oz, diced tomatoes
1 small green bell pepper, deseeded, roughly chopped 
1 small red bell pepper, deseeded, roughly chopped 
1 medium red onion, roughly chopped 
2 cloves garlic 
Chipotle in adobo sauce, ½ pepper (or as per taste)  
Habanero pepper, 1 ct (optional) 
3-4 tbsp, fresh lime juice (or as per taste) 
Handful of fresh cilantro 
Salt to taste


Instructions:
Add all the ingredients into a food processor. Pulse few times, to get desired consistency. Enjoy!!


Note(s):

  1. A distinctive smoky flavor and spiciness in salsa is achieved by using chipotle pepper, and use of Habanero adds extra spiciness to this salsa. Habanero pepper may be substituted with jalapeno or Serrano pepper, for a milder salsa. Please adjust the spice level as per taste.
  2. The consistency of salsa can be adjusted as per taste. You can keep it chunky or smooth as desired. 
  3. The spiciness can be adjusted to taste, you can add jalapeno pepper to make it spicy.
  4. Fresh tomatoes may be substituted in place of can tomatoes.
